Types of Telegram Ads in Affiliate Marketing
1. Sponsored Messages
Sponsored messages are Telegram’s official ad format, available in public channels with 1,000 or more subscribers. The minimum budget requirement for this format makes it accessible, even for smaller campaigns, while allowing precise targeting. These short, text-based ads appear at the bottom of channel posts, with a clear "Sponsored" label.
The platform's special feature is a strict limit on the number of characters. The advertising text should be short but catchy. However, there is very little advertising on the platform, and users have not yet developed banner blindness. Therefore, such short advertisements can achieve very good results.
2. Channel Partnerships
Many affiliate marketers collaborate directly with Telegram channel owners to promote their offers. This involves:
Buying Posts: Paying for a single or series of posts that promote your affiliate link.
Revenue Share: Offering the channel owner a commission for every sale or lead generated through their channel.
The second option of cooperation is great for working with small Telegram channels. They do not have enough advertisers yet. Or advertisers offer them too little money for advertising. By sharing profits with channel owners, you can get a lot of quality advertising without initial financial investments. Moreover, channel authors often write advertising themselves and natively implement it in their posts, which gives a higher conversion than buying paid ads.
Additional Advice:
To evaluate a channel’s credibility, check its historical posts for consistent engagement. A channel with sudden spikes in followers or views may have used bot services.
3. Bot Advertising
Telegram bots are automated accounts that provide specific services.
If you choose a bot, then you have 2 possible advertising placements.
1. Integrate your referral link into the bot interface
2. Send an advertisement as a message to bot users (analogous to an email newsletter)
Another option is to create your own chatbot and launch it in Telegram Ads.
Similar to channel promotion, you can either buy advertisements from bot owners or offer them a referral percentage of sales.
4. Content Marketing in Groups and Channels
Many successful affiliates create their own Telegram channels or groups to promote their products indirectly. This involves:
Building an Audience: Sharing valuable content (e.g., tips, guides, and resources) related to the affiliate niche.
Subtle Promotions: Including affiliate links in posts, discussions, or pinned messages.
Example: An affiliate marketer in the tech space runs a channel sharing software tutorials and occasionally promotes discounted SaaS tools using affiliate links.
5. Sponsored Contests or Giveaways
Organizing contests and giveaways in collaboration with Telegram channels or groups can drive significant traffic. This involves:
Prizes Sponsored by Affiliates: Offering free products, subscriptions, or gift cards.
Entry Requirements: Participants may need to sign up using an affiliate link or follow certain steps that drive conversions.
Key Steps to Start with Telegram Ads for Affiliate Marketing
Step 1: Define Your Niche and Audience
Focus on a specific niche and understand the demographics, interests, and pain points of your target audience. For example, a gaming niche will perform well in Telegram channels dedicated to eSports or game reviews.
Step 2: Research Channels and Groups
Use tools like TGStat to identify relevant channels with high engagement rates. These tools provide insights into audience demographics, engagement trends, and content performance, helping you choose channels that align with your campaign goals. Look for:
Audience size and engagement (views per post).
Thematic alignment with your niche.
User feedback and comments within the channel.
Pro Tip:
Engagement rate is calculated as the average number of views divided by the number of subscribers. Aim for channels with at least a 10-20% engagement rate.
Step 3: Analyze Ad Performance
Once you start advertising, track key metrics:
CTR (Click-Through Rate): Indicates how engaging your ad content is.
Conversion Rate: Measures how many clicks lead to desired actions (e.g., sign-ups, purchases).
ROMI: Calculate the overall profitability of your campaigns.
Advanced Suggestion:
Use unique UTM parameters or affiliate links for each campaign to track performance more effectively.
Step 4: Optimize Creatives
Test different ad formats, copy, and visuals. A/B testing can help determine what resonates most with your audience.
